Balnarring Byways and Memories Volume 2.This is a compendium of personal recollections by local people, many of whom were members of the Balnarring and District Historical Society. It was edited by Christine Sinclair and Carole Wilson and published in November 1996.

Coolart : a short historyThe Meyrick cousins were the first leaseholders of Coolart, and after they left in 1846 the lease was sold four times until 1875, when the government cancelled the lease and sold the land as freehold. Frederick Sheppard Grimwade bought the property in 1895 as a country retreat and sold it in 1907 due to ill health.
